Medical emergency causes man to crash into pole on Paris (Photos)

Crash closed two lanes of traffic for nearly an hour

A single-vehicle crash that closed two lanes of traffic on Paris Street late yesterday afternoon occurred after the driver suffered a medical emergency.

The nature of the emergency is unknown at this time, but it caused the 69-year-old man to crash into a traffic light pole at the Four Corners.

Greater Sudbury Police could not say the nature of that emergency, but did confirm the man was transported to hospital in distress.

The accident occurred around 3 p.m. on May 17. The two northbound lanes of Paris Street were closed for about 40 minutes as a result of the incident.

Police were unable to provide information on the condition of the victim this morning.
